Religious people aren’t always who they think they are. In Romans 2:17–3:8, Paul exposes a dangerous kind of self-deception—where knowing God’s law doesn’t mean obeying it. If you’ve ever relied on your knowledge, your obedience, or your identity as a Christian… this passage will challenge you.
